ASU Beach Volleyball Dominates Home Invitational

News Summary

The ASU Beach Volleyball team delivered an impressive performance at the ASU/GCU Invitational, winning all four matches and improving their overall record to 14-8. With a highlight victory over ranked No. 19 Washington, the Sand Devils showcased their talent and determination. Junior duo Kendall Whitmarsh and Tori Clement continued their winning streak, earning recognition as Big 12 Pair of the Week. The team’s positive mindset and strong camaraderie, along with enthusiastic fan support, have propelled them forward as they prepare for challenging matches against top-ranked opponents in the coming weeks.

ASU Beach Volleyball Shines Bright at Home Invitational

What a thrilling weekend it was in Tempe, Arizona as the ASU Beach Volleyball team put on quite a show at the ASU/GCU Invitational! Not only did they dominate the competition, but they also chased away any doubts about their potential with an impressive performance. In a home turf extravaganza, the Sand Devils soared to success, winning all four of their matches. This brings their overall record to a solid 14-8, while their home record stands at a dazzling 7-1.

Off to a Winning Start

The tournament kicked off for the Sand Devils with a magnificent 5-0 victory over UAB. It was a clear indication that they meant serious business, and the energy only built from there. Over the course of the weekend, the team dropped just two duels, showcasing their prowess on the sand. The highlight during the Invitational was undoubtedly their 4-1 triumph over the ranked No. 19 Washington team, a match that really set the tone for the Sand Devils’ confidence moving forward.

A Dynamic Duo

One of the standout partnerships this season has been that of junior Kendall Whitmarsh and her partner Tori Clement. This duo has been on quite the winning streak, boasting an impressive record of 10-2 together. Their skills are shining bright as they have won a remarkable nine consecutive duels, earning them the title of Big 12 Pair of the Week after an exceptional run against several ranked teams. It’s safe to say that when these two take the sand, victory isn’t too far behind!

What Lies Ahead

Looking ahead, the next two weeks promise to be an exhilarating ride for the Sand Devils, with rematches coming up against formidable opponents including the No. 2 UCLA and TCU, who currently hold a record of 15-3. Additionally, they will also face off against Loyola Marymount (24-2). The excitement kicks off with their first match against TCU on April 5, but not before they take on No. 8 Pepperdine on April 4 at noon in Tucson.
